Signs You Have a Broken Garage Door Spring
Recognizing a Broken Garage Door Spring early can prevent further damage. Here are some common signs to watch for:
- Loud bang from the garage – Springs often break with a sudden snapping sound.
- Door won’t open fully – The opener may struggle or stop midway.
- Crooked or uneven door movement – One side may lift higher than the other.
- Heavy door when lifting manually – If the door feels unusually heavy, the spring is likely compromised.
- Visible gap in the spring – Torsion springs often show a clear separation when broken.
If you notice any of these issues, avoid operating the door repeatedly. Continuing to use it can strain the opener and other components.
What Causes Garage Door Springs to Break?
Garage door springs are designed to handle thousands of cycles, but they don’t last forever. Several factors contribute to spring failure:
Normal wear and tear: Most springs are rated for about 10,000 cycles (one cycle equals one open and close). Over time, metal fatigue sets in.
Extreme temperature changes: In Colorado, USA, fluctuating weather conditions can cause metal to contract and expand, weakening the spring.
Rust and corrosion: Lack of maintenance can allow rust to build up, increasing friction and reducing lifespan.
Improper maintenance: Without regular inspection and lubrication, springs wear out faster than expected.
Routine maintenance can extend the life of your springs, but once you have a Broken Garage Door Spring, professional replacement is the safest solution.
Why Professional Spring Repair Is Essential
Replacing a garage door spring is not a DIY-friendly task. Springs are under high tension and can cause serious injury if handled incorrectly. Professional technicians have the proper tools, training, and safety procedures to complete the job safely and efficiently.
